A magnificent 4-bore (4in) hammer wild-fowling hammer gun by R. Rodda & Co., no. 13882
Jones patent rotary-underlever, non-rebounding backlocks, best foliate-scroll engraving, much hardening-colour, well figured stock (chip and repair at toe) with iron butt-plate, the expertly rebrowned damascus barrels with the rib engraved R.B. RODDA & CO. GUN MAKERS TO H.E. THE VICEROY AND H.R.H. THE DUKE OF EDINBURGH. LONDON & CALCUTTA
Weight 15lb. 8oz., 14 3/8in. pull, 38in. barrels, 4in. chambers, Black Powder reproof
In its leather case
